Sunucular

VPS Sunucusu Nasıl Kurulur?

VPS Sunucusu Nasıl Kurulur?
Share

VPS Sunucusu: Yeni Nesil Web Hosting Çözümü

Sanal Özel Sunucu (VPS), günümüzde web sitesi sahipleri tarafından tercih edilen bir hosting çözümüdür. Daha önceki yazılarımızda hosting türleri hakkında genel bir bilgi vermiştik. Ancak VPS sunucusu, diğer hosting seçeneklerine göre daha fazla özelleştirmeye imkan tanımaktadır. Bu noktada, VPS sunucusunun ne olduğunu ve nasıl çalıştığını anlamak, doğru bir tercih yapmanız için önemlidir. Ayrıca, VPS sunucusunu seçerken nelere dikkat etmeniz gerektiği, kurulum adımları ve güvenlik önlemleri gibi konular da oldukça önemlidir. Bu blog yazımızda, VPS sunucusuyla ilgili merak ettiğiniz tüm detayları bulabilirsiniz. Ayrıca, popüler yazılımlar ve sunucuyu optimize etmek için ipuçlarıyla birlikte sizlere daha iyi bir VPS deneyimi sunmaya çalışacağız.

VPS sunucusu nedir ve nasıl çalışır?

VPS (Virtual Private Server), bir fiziksel sunucunun bölümlendirilerek sanal sunucular oluşturulduğu bir hizmettir. Her VPS, özelleştirilmiş bir işletim sistemi ve kaynaklara sahip bağımsız bir sunucu gibi davranır. Bu sayede, birden fazla kullanıcı aynı fiziksel sunucuyu paylaşabilir ancak birbirlerinden tamamen ayrı sunucularda çalışıyor gibi hissederler.

VPS sunucusu nasıl çalışır?

Öncelikle, fiziksel bir sunucu, özel bir sanallaştırma yazılımı kullanılarak bölümlere ayrılır. Bu bölümler, her biri kendi kaynaklarına ve işletim sistemine sahip olan bağımsız sanal sunucular oluşturmak için kullanılır. Her VPS, CPU gücü, bellek, depolama ve ağ kaynakları gibi belirli bir miktar kaynağa sahiptir.

VPS sunucuları, kullanıcılarına tam kök erişim ve kontrol imkanı sağlar. Kullanıcılar, VPS’lerinde istedikleri işletim sistemini yükleyebilir, özel ayarlamalar yapabilir ve kendi uygulamalarını çalıştırabilir. Aynı zamanda, VPS sunucusunu diğer kullanıcılar ile paylaşırken hiçbir kaynak veya performans sorunu yaşamazlar.

VPS Sunucusunun Avantajları
  • Daha uygun maliyetli bir çözüm sunar
  • Ölçeklenebilirlik ve esneklik sağlar
  • Kendinize ait kaynaklar sunar
  • VPS sunucusu, kullanıcıların web sitelerini barındırmaları, uygulamalarını çalıştırmaları veya verilerini depolamaları için ideal bir seçenektir. Kullanıcılar, kendi ihtiyaçlarına ve bütçelerine göre kaynakları özelleştirebilir ve istedikleri gibi kontrol sahibi olabilirler. Bu nedenle, VPS sunucusu tercih eden birçok şirket ve bireysel kullanıcı bulunmaktadır.

    VPS sunucusunu seçerken nelere dikkat etmeli?

    VPS (Virtual Private Server), web sitelerinin barındırılması ve yönetilmesi için ideal bir çözümdür. Ancak, doğru VPS sunucusunu seçmek, sitenizin performansı ve güvenliği için oldukça önemlidir. İşte VPS sunucusunu seçerken dikkat etmeniz gereken bazı önemli noktalar:

    1. İhtiyaçlarınızı belirleyin: Öncelikle, sitenizin ihtiyaçlarını belirlemek önemlidir. Bunu yapmak için trafik tahminlerinizi, depolama gereksinimlerinizi ve diğer teknik özellikleri gözden geçirin. Buna göre, CPU, RAM, HDD veya SSD gibi sunucu özelliklerini belirleyebilirsiniz.
    2. Güvenlik önlemlerine dikkat edin: VPS sağlayıcısının güvenlik önlemlerini araştırmanız önemlidir. Sunucunun güncellemeleri nasıl yönettiğini, güvenlik duvarı ve sızma testi gibi önlemleri aldığını öğrenin. Ayrıca, verilerinizi yedeklemek ve korumak için sunucu üzerinde güvenlik önlemleri alabilmeniz önemlidir.
    3. Teknik desteği kontrol edin: VPS sunucusu seçerken sağlayıcının teknik destek kalitesini değerlendirmek önemlidir. 7/24 erişilebilir, hızlı ve uzman bir destek ekibine sahip olmaları, sorunların hızlı bir şekilde çözülmesini sağlar.
    Karşılaştırma Tablosu: VPS Sunucusu Seçimi

    Özellikler Plan A Plan B Plan C
    Disk Alanı 50GB 100GB 200GB
    RAM 4GB 8GB 16GB
    CPU Çekirdek Sayısı 2 4 8

    VPS sunucusu kurulumu için gereken adımlar

    VPS (Virtual Private Server) sunucusu, bir fiziksel sunucunun sanal bir kopyası olan bir sanal özel sunucudur. VPS sunucuları, tek bir fiziksel sunucunun kaynaklarını birden fazla kullanıcı arasında paylaşan sanallaştırma teknolojisi kullanır. VPS sunucusu kurulumu yaparken bazı önemli adımları takip etmek önemlidir.

    1. İhtiyaç Analizi: VPS sunucusu kurulumuna başlamadan önce ihtiyaçlarınızı belirlemek önemlidir. Hangi amaçla kullanacağınızı ve hangi kaynaklara ihtiyaç duyduğunuzu belirlemek, doğru VPS seçimini yapmanıza yardımcı olacaktır.

    2. VPS Sağlayıcı Seçimi: Birçok VPS sağlayıcısı vardır ve özellikleri, fiyatları ve sunulan hizmetler açısından farklılık gösterebilir. Güvenilir bir sağlayıcı seçmek, sunucunuzun performansı ve güvenliği için önemlidir.

    3. Plan ve Konfigürasyon Seçimi: Seçtiğiniz VPS sağlayıcısının sunmuş olduğu planları inceleyerek size uygun olanı seçmelisiniz. İhtiyaçlarınıza uygun kaynaklar (RAM, CPU, depolama alanı) ve işletim sistemi seçimi yapmalısınız.

    4. Sunucu Kurulumu: VPS sağlayıcınız tarafından sağlanan yönergeleri takip ederek sunucunuzu kurmalısınız. Kurulum sürecinde, işletim sistemi, güvenlik önlemleri ve diğer gereksinimler için gerekli adımları izlemelisiniz.

    5. Güvenlik Ayarları: VPS sunucusunun güvenliği önemlidir. Güçlü bir parola kullanmalı, güncel yazılım ve güvenlik duvarı gibi önlemler almalısınız. Ayrıca, önemli verileri yedeklemeyi unutmamalısınız.

    6. Yazılım Yükleme: İhtiyaçlarınıza uygun yazılımları VPS sunucusuna yüklemelisiniz. Web sunucusu (Apache, Nginx), veritabanı sunucusu (MySQL, PostgreSQL) ve diğer gereksinimlerinizi kurmalısınız.

    7. Optimizasyon ve Bakım: VPS sunucusunun performansını artırmak için optimizasyon adımları uygulayabilirsiniz. Önbellekleme, dosya sıkıştırma, gereksiz hizmetleri devre dışı bırakma gibi tekniklerle sunucunuzu optimize edebilirsiniz. Ayrıca, düzenli bakım yapmalı ve güncelleştirmeleri takip etmelisiniz.

    Bu adımları takip ederek, sorunsuz bir şekilde VPS sunucusu kurulumu yapabilir ve ihtiyaçlarınıza uygun bir sanal ortam oluşturabilirsiniz.

    • VPS sunucusu ihtiyaçlarınızı analiz edin
    • Güvenilir bir VPS sağlayıcısı seçin
    • Plan ve konfigürasyon seçimini yapın
    • Sunucunuzu kurun ve güvenlik ayarlarını yapın
    • İhtiyaçlarınıza uygun yazılımları yükleyin
    • Sunucunuzu optimize edin ve düzenli bakım yapın
    Adım Açıklama
    1 İhtiyaç Analizi
    2 VPS Sağlayıcı Seçimi
    3 Plan ve Konfigürasyon Seçimi
    4 Sunucu Kurulumu
    5 Güvenlik Ayarları
    6 Yazılım Yükleme
    7 Optimizasyon ve Bakım

    VPS sunucusunda hangi işletim sistemini tercih etmelisiniz?

    Bir sanal sunucu (VPS), birden fazla kullanıcının aynı fiziksel sunucuyu paylaştığı ancak her kullanıcının kendi özel sanal sunucusunu yönettiği bir sunucu türüdür. Bir VPS kullanmanın birçok avantajı vardır, ancak tercih edilecek işletim sistemi seçimi önemlidir. Çünkü işletim sistemi, sunucunun performansını, güvenliğini ve özelleştirilebilirliğini etkileyebilir.

    List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List List

    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table Table

    VPS sunucusunda güvenlik önlemleri nasıl alınmalı?

    Web sitelerini barındırmak için sanal özel sunucular (VPS) günümüzde yaygın olarak kullanılmaktadır. VPS sunucuları, kullanıcılara daha fazla kontrol ve esneklik sağlayarak, paylaşımlı hosting hizmetlerine kıyasla daha iyi bir performans sunar. Ancak, VPS kullanırken güvenlik önlemleri almak önemlidir.

    1. Fiziksel ve yazılımsal güvenlik: VPS sağlayıcınızın fiziksel sunucularının güvenli bir data merkezinde barındırıldığından emin olun. Ayrıca, güvenlik duvarları, güncel yazılımlar ve izinsiz erişimleri engellemek için gereken diğer önlemleri alın.

    2. Güçlü parolalar kullanın: Şifreleriniz güçlü, karmaşık ve tahmin edilmesi zor olmalıdır. Rakam, harf ve sembollerin kombinasyonunu kullanarak daha güçlü parolalar oluşturun. Ayrıca, düzenli olarak şifrelerinizi değiştirmeyi unutmayın.

    3. Güncel yazılımlar kullanın: VPS sunucusunda kullandığınız yazılımların güncel olduğundan emin olun. Güncellemeler, güvenlik açıklarını düzeltmek ve potansiyel saldırıları önlemek için önemlidir. Otomatik güncelleme özelliği olan bir kontrol paneli kullanmanız faydalı olabilir.

    • 4. Veri yedeklemesi: Verilerinizi yedeklemek önemlidir. Düzenli olarak veri yedeklemeleri yaparak, olası bir veri kaybı durumunda verilerinizi kurtarabilirsiniz. Yedeklemeleri güvenli bir yerde depolamayı unutmayın.
    Güvenlik Önlemi Neden Önemli
    SSL Sertifikası SSL sertifikası, kullanıcıların iletişimde olduğu web sitesiyle şifreli bir bağlantı kurmasını sağlar. Bu da kullanıcı bilgilerinin güvenliğini sağlar.
    Güvenlik Duvarı Bir güvenlik duvarı, ağınızı kötü amaçlı saldırılardan korur ve izinsiz erişimleri engeller.
    Antivirüs Programı Antivirüs programı, zararlı yazılımları algılayarak sisteminizi korur ve saldırılara karşı önlem almanıza yardımcı olur.

    Güvenli bir VPS sunucusu kullanırken bu önlemleri almak, web sitenizin güvenliğini sağlamada önemli bir adımdır. Unutmayın, güvenlik konusunda aldığınız önlemler, olası saldırılara karşı savunmanızı güçlendirir ve kullanıcılarınızın güvenini sağlar.

    VPS sunucusunda kullanabileceğiniz popüler yazılımlar

    VPS (Sanal Özel Sunucu), günümüzde birçok işletmenin tercih ettiği bir hosting çözümüdür. Sanal sunucular, kaynakları paylaşılan paylaşımlı hostingden daha güçlü bir performans sergiler ve özelleştirme imkanı sunar. VPS sunucusunda kullanabileceğiniz popüler yazılımlar, işletmenizin ihtiyaçlarına ve hedeflerinize bağlı olarak değişebilir. Ancak, aşağıda listelenen bazı popüler yazılımlar, VPS sunucunuzda daha verimli bir şekilde çalışmanızı sağlayabilir.

    1. WordPress:

    WordPress, web sitesi oluşturmak ve yönetmek için en popüler içerik yönetimi sistemlerinden biridir. VPS sunucunuzda WordPress’i kullanarak, özelleştirilebilir bir web sitesi oluşturabilir ve içeriği kolayca yönetebilirsiniz. Ayrıca, eklentiler ve temalar kullanarak web sitenizi genişletebilir ve özelleştirebilirsiniz.

    2. Magento:

    E-ticaret işletmeleri için Magento, en popüler açık kaynaklı e-ticaret platformlarından biridir. VPS sunucunuzda Magento’yu kullanarak, güçlü bir e-ticaret web sitesi oluşturabilir, ürünleri yönetebilir, ödeme ve gönderim işlemlerini kolayca yönetebilirsiniz. Magento’nun geniş eklenti ve tema desteği, işletmenizin özel ihtiyaçlarına uygun bir çözüm sunar.

    3. cPanel:

    cPanel, web sitesi yönetiminde kullanılan bir kontrol panelidir. VPS sunucunuzda cPanel’i kullanarak, web sitelerinizi kolayca yönetebilir, veritabanlarını oluşturabilir, e-posta hesapları oluşturabilir ve güvenlik ayarlarını yapılandırabilirsiniz. cPanel ayrıca bir dosya yöneticisi, FTP erişimi ve yedekleme özellikleri sunar.

    Yazılım İşlevi
    WordPress Web sitesi oluşturma ve yönetme
    Magento E-ticaret web sitesi oluşturma ve yönetme
    cPanel Web sitesi yönetimi ve kontrol paneli

    Tablo: VPS sunucusunda kullanabileceğiniz popüler yazılımlar ve işlevleri.

    Yukarıda bahsedilen yazılımlar, VPS sunucunuzda kullanabileceğiniz sadece birkaç örnektir. İşletmenizin gereksinimlerine göre diğer popüler yazılımlar da tercih edilebilir. Önemli olan, VPS sunucusunda kullanılacak yazılımların güncel ve güvenli olması ve işletmenizin hedeflerini destekleyebilmesidir. İhtiyaçlarınızı doğru bir şekilde değerlendirerek, VPS sunucusunda verimli bir şekilde çalışmanızı sağlayacak yazılımları seçebilirsiniz.

    VPS sunucusunu optimize etmek için ipuçları

    VPS sunucusunu optimize etmek, web sitenizin hızını artırır ve performansını en üst düzeye çıkarabilir. Bu, kullanıcı deneyimini iyileştirmenin yanı sıra arama motoru sıralamalarını da etkileyebilir. İşte VPS sunucusunu optimize etmek için ipuçlarının bir listesi:

    1) İhtiyaçlarınızı Belirleyin: Öncelikle, web sitenizin ihtiyaçlarını ve trafik hacmini belirleyin. Bu, sunucu kaynaklarınızı yönetmenize ve optimize etmenize yardımcı olacaktır. Örneğin, yüksek trafikli bir e-ticaret sitesi daha fazla işlemci ve bellek gerektirebilir.

    2) Yüksek Performanslı Bir Sunucu Seçin: VPS sunucusu seçerken, hızlı bir işlemci, yeterli RAM ve SSD depolama gibi yüksek performanslı özelliklere sahip olanı tercih edin. Bu, web sitenizin daha hızlı yüklenmesine ve kullanıcıların daha iyi bir deneyim yaşamasına yardımcı olur.

    3) Cache Kullanın: Önbellekleme, web sitenizin hızını artırmak için önemlidir. Önbellekleme, sunucudan statik içeriklerin (CSS, JavaScript, resimler vb.) saklanması ve kullanıcılara daha hızlı bir şekilde sunulması anlamına gelir. Bu, sayfa yüklemelerini hızlandırır ve sunucu kaynaklarınıza daha verimli bir şekilde kullanmanızı sağlar.

    • 4) CDN Kullanın: CDN (İçerik Dağıtım Ağı), web sitenizi dünya çapındaki sunuculara dağıtarak içeriklerin daha hızlı yüklenmesini sağlar. Bu, kullanıcıların web sitenize daha hızlı erişmesini sağlar ve sunucu yükünü azaltır.
    • 5) Veritabanını Optimize Edin: Veritabanı, web sitenizin verilerini depoladığı önemli bir bileşendir. Veritabanını optimize etmek, veri sorgularının daha hızlı çalışmasını ve web sitenizin daha iyi performans sergilemesini sağlar. Veritabanındaki gereksiz verileri temizlemek ve indeksleri düzenlemek gibi optimizasyon teknikleri kullanın.
    • 6) Script ve Eklentileri Güncel Tutun: Kullandığınız scriptler ve eklentilerin güncel versiyonlarını kullanmak, performans sorunlarını azaltır ve güvenlik açıklarını en aza indirir. Güncellemeleri takip etmek ve periyodik olarak güncellemeleri yapmak önemlidir.
    İpucu Açıklama
    7) Dosya Sıkıştırma: Web sitenizde kullandığınız dosyaları (CSS, JavaScript, HTML) sıkıştırarak dosya boyutlarını azaltın. Bu, sayfa yüklemelerini hızlandırır ve veri transferini azaltır.
    8) Gereksiz Eklentileri Kaldırın: Kullandığınız eklentilerin gerçekten ihtiyaç duyulan özellikleri sunup sunmadığını değerlendirin. Gereksiz eklentiler, sunucu kaynaklarını tüketir ve performansa olumsuz etki yapabilir.
    9) Log Dosyalarını Temizleyin: Sunucunuzdaki log dosyalarını düzenli olarak temizleyin. Bu, sunucu kaynaklarını serbest bırakır ve daha verimli çalışmasını sağlar.